The Artist

Warren Curry was born in Yarram in country Victoria, Australia. He studied painting and sculpture at the City and Guilds School of Art London, and drawing at the Byam Shaw Art School, London. In 1971 while on vacation
from art school Warren, accompanied by two fellow students, went on a painting
trip to Greece. His love of Greece was further enhanced when in 1981
he won a Travel Study Grant and was to spend three months painting in the
village of Liapades on Corfu. Returning to Corfu in 1998 he spent
two months painting in the village of Pelekas.

During his stay in Pelekas,
Warren finalised arrangements to bring other Australian artists to Corfu.
Now in its forth year of operation the Art Tours provide artists with the
opportunity to enjoy the dramatic scenery, wonderful villages and colourful
traditions of this island paradise.
Warren has held seventeen Solo Exhibitions in Australia and won over thirty major art awards. His work is represented in Australian Government (Art Bank) Regional Collections, Corporate and overseas collections. In Australia, he works from his studio located in the small fishing village of Port Albert in South Gippsland, east of Melbourne. |
